O R D E R

This criminal original petition has been filed, invoking under Section 482 Cr.P.C., seeking orders to set aside the order passed in Criminal Revision No.16 of 2018 dated 14.09.2018 on the file of the learned I Additional District and Sessions Court, Tiruchirappalli, modified the order passed in Cr.M.P.No.9412 of 2017 dated 08.03.2018 in DVC No.49 of 2017 on the file of the learned Additional Mahila Court, Tiruchirappalli.

2.When the matter was taken up for hearing on 10.01.2022, this Court has directed the Registry to get a report from the learned I Additional District and Sessions Judge, Tiruchirappalli. 3.In pursuance of the same, the learned I Additional District and Sessions Judge, Tiruchirappalli, has submitted a report on 21.01.2022 stating that that Court has passed an modified order on 14.09.2018 in Criminal Revision No.16 of 2018 and that Criminal Revision No.16 of 2018 alone was disposed and as per the instructions received the original case in DVC No.49 of 2017 pending on the file of the Additional Mahila Court, Tiruchirappalli is posted for mediation.

Crl.O.P.(MD)No.22567 of 2018 4.When the matter is taken up for hearing today, the learned counsel for the petitioner as well as the respondent would submit that the matter was settled between the parties and hence, nothing survives for further adjudication.

5.Recording the submission made by the learned counsel for the petitioner as well as the respondent, this criminal original petition is dismissed as infructuous. Consequently, connected miscellaneous petition is closed.
